Tour Highlights
Explore the vibrant Piazza delle Erbe, Verona's historic market square framed by Baroque palaces and the Madonna Verona fountain.
Admire the Lamberti Tower, a 12th-century medieval landmark offering commanding views over the city's historic rooftops.
Visit Juliet's House, the world-famous site tied to Shakespeare's timeless story, located in the heart of the old city.
Cross the ancient Ponte Pietra, a Roman bridge spanning the Adige River with origins dating to the 1st century BC.
Stand inside the Roman Theater, an archaeological site from the 1st century AD that still hosts cultural performances today.
Discover the Gothic Scaligeri Tombs, monumental funerary monuments that reflect the power of Verona's medieval ruling dynasty.
Explore Piazza dei Signori and the Verona Cathedral, two architectural landmarks that anchor the city's cultural and civic identity.
Tour Itinerary
The tour begins at Verona's oldest square, a lively marketplace surrounded by colorful historic buildings including the Baroque Palazzo Maffei. The Madonna Verona fountain at its center has stood since the 14th century, repurposed from a Roman statue.
Rising above the city since the 12th century, the Lamberti Tower defines Verona's medieval skyline. Nearby Piazza dei Signori, flanked by the Loggia del Consiglio and the Palazzo del Capitano, reflects the city's civic and Renaissance heritage.
The Gothic funerary monuments of the Scaligeri family stand as enduring symbols of medieval power in Verona. The tour then moves to Casa di Giulietta, the house associated with Shakespeare's Juliet and one of the city's most visited sites.
The ancient Ponte Pietra bridge, the well-preserved Roman Theater, and the Romanesque Verona Cathedral complete the itinerary. Each of these landmarks spans a different era, together illustrating the full arc of Verona's history from antiquity to the Middle Ages.
